The Basenji Breed: A Brief Overview
Before diving into the pricing details, let’s briefly explore what makes the Basenji unique:
- Origin: The Basenji hails from Central Africa, where it was traditionally used for hunting due to its keen senses and speed.
- Appearance: This medium-sized dog has a sleek, muscular body, a short coat, and distinctive erect ears. Its coat comes in various colors, including black, brindle, red, and tri-color.
- Temperament: Basenjis are known for their independence, intelligence, and loyalty. They are not overly affectionate but form strong bonds with their families.
- Behavior: One of the most distinctive features of the Basenji is its inability to bark. Instead, it produces a unique yodel-like sound known as a “barroo.”
Factors Influencing the Price of Basenji Dogs in India
Several factors can influence the cost of a Basenji dog in India. Understanding these factors can help you gauge a reasonable price and make an informed decision.
1. Pedigree and Lineage
The lineage of a Basenji plays a significant role in determining its price. Dogs from champion bloodlines or with superior genetics typically cost more. Reputable breeders who focus on maintaining the breed’s standard often charge higher prices for their dogs.
2. Breeder Reputation
Reputable breeders who invest time and resources into the health and well-being of their dogs will generally charge higher prices. They ensure that the dogs are healthy, well-socialized, and adhere to breed standards. It’s essential to research and choose a breeder with a strong reputation to avoid issues related to health and temperament.
3. Location
The price of Basenji dogs can vary depending on the location within India. Urban areas with higher living costs and greater demand for purebred dogs often see higher prices compared to rural areas.
4. Health and Wellness
Basenjis from breeders who focus on health testing and vaccinations will typically have higher prices. Health screenings for conditions common in the breed, such as Fanconi syndrome, contribute to the overall cost.
5. Age and Training
Puppies are usually more expensive than adult dogs. However, if an adult Basenji has received training and socialization, its price might be higher than that of a younger, untrained dog.
6. Additional Costs
Consider additional costs such as initial veterinary care, vaccinations, microchipping, and registration. These can add to the overall cost of acquiring a Basenji.
Average Price Range for Basenji Dogs in India
The cost of Basenji dogs in India can vary widely based on the factors mentioned above. On average, you can expect the following price ranges:
- Pet Quality Basenji: ₹30,000 to ₹50,000
- Show Quality Basenji: ₹50,000 to ₹80,000
- Champion Lineage Basenji: ₹80,000 to ₹1,20,000 or more
These prices can fluctuate based on demand, breeder location, and other market conditions.
Where to Find Basenji Dogs in India
Finding a Basenji in India involves research and careful consideration. Here are some avenues to explore:
1. Reputable Breeders
The best way to find a healthy and well-bred Basenji is through reputable breeders. Look for breeders who are members of recognized kennel clubs and have a history of ethical breeding practices.
2. Kennel Clubs and Breed Clubs
Contact local kennel clubs or breed-specific organizations for recommendations. These clubs often have breeder directories and can provide information on where to find Basenjis.
3. Online Platforms
Several online platforms and websites list dogs for sale. However, exercise caution when using these platforms and ensure you verify the legitimacy of the seller. Avoid purchasing from sources with questionable reputations.
4. Dog Shows and Events
Attending dog shows and breed-specific events can provide opportunities to meet Basenji breeders and owners. These events also offer a chance to see the breed in person and make connections with reputable breeders.
Tips for Prospective Basenji Owners
If you’re considering bringing a Basenji into your home, here are some tips to ensure a successful adoption:
1. Research the Breed
Before purchasing a Basenji, thoroughly research the breed’s characteristics, needs, and potential challenges. Basenjis have specific needs and may not be suitable for first-time dog owners.
2. Visit the Breeder
Always visit the breeder’s facility to see the conditions in which the dogs are raised. This will help you assess the health and well-being of the puppies and their parents.
3. Ask for References
Request references from previous buyers to gauge the breeder’s reputation and the experiences of other dog owners.
4. Health Guarantees
Ensure that the breeder provides health guarantees and has conducted necessary health screenings. This can help prevent future health issues and unexpected veterinary costs.
5. Prepare Your Home
Prepare your home for a Basenji by ensuring you have the necessary supplies, including food, water bowls, bedding, and toys. Basenjis are active dogs, so provide opportunities for exercise and mental stimulation.
